Webb22 juni 2024 · The Philippines’ property tax-to-GDP ratio has been decreasing since 2003, settling at only 0.5 percent as of 2024, which is the same as Thailand’s, and way lower than the 2-percent average set by the Organization for … Webb2 juni 2024 · What is property tax in the Philippines? A property tax is any tax that you pay on property that you buy, sell, own or rent. Property in the Philippines means not just buildings, but land and even machinery as well. There are a number of taxes to pay if you have property in the Philippines, the key ones of which are outlined below.
Webb2 mars 2024 · Property is subject to an annual tax based on its appraised value. The amount of this tax varies based on the district. But the rate is capped at 1% for properties located within Metro Manila, and 2% for those outside the city. Rental income is also subject to personal income tax for Philippine residents. Webb25 jan. 2024 · A Philippine (domestic) corporation is taxed on its worldwide income. A domestic corporation is taxed on income from foreign sources when earned or received, depending on the accounting method used by the taxpayer. Income earned through a foreign subsidiary is taxed only when paid to a Philippine resident shareholder as a …
